The Department of Energy’s Water Power Technologies Office (WPTO)  is currently accepting applications for the Marine and Hydrokinetic Graduate Student Research Program. The program is open to full-time doctoral students with a research thesis and/or dissertation at a U.S. institution, and Sandia National Laboratories is an approved host facility for Fellows.

As stated on the WPTO website, the program is designed to “advance the graduate student’s overall doctoral thesis while providing access to the expertise, resources, and capabilities available at DOE offices, national laboratories, industry, and other approved facilities where the participant will conduct part of their research.”

The Marine and Hydrokinetic Graduate Student Research Program is funded by WPTO and administered by the Oak Ridge Institute for Science and Education.

The application deadline is 5:00 p.m. EST, Dec. 10, 2021.
